Analysis

In 2013, malaysia — fibreboard — import quantity in Cyprus stood at 7 m3. That is the lowest value across all 9 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 92.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, malaysia — fibreboard — import quantity in Cyprus peaked at 2,688 m3 in 1999 and was at its lowest, 7 m3, in 2013.

That places Cyprus 76th out of 81 countries with data for 2013,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
